Tue, Jan 18, 2022 @ Roosevelt
Kamuela Kaaihue scored 16 points with eight rebounds and Kody Seguancia had 12 points and stuffed the stat sheet with five boards, five assists and five steals to help Roosevelt fend off visiting Kaimuki, 44-39, in an OIA East contest Tuesday night.
The Rough Riders (3-1 OIA D1 East) held a 33-19 lead after three quarter before the Bulldogs (2-2 OIA D2 East) mounted a comeback bid behind their full-court press.
Kaaihue was a valuable safety valve in Roosevelt's press breaker as he scored eight of his game-high 16 points in the fourth quarter.
Rashawn Fritz-Betiru led Kaimuki in the loss with 13 points.
